Usage Note
Conforme is invariable — the masculine and feminine forms are identical. It is most often followed by à (conforme à la loi — 'in accordance with the law'). It appears heavily in legal, technical, and administrative French. The related noun conformité (f) is used in regulations and certifications, and conformément à is a formal preposition meaning 'in accordance with'.
Examples
"Le produit est conforme aux normes européennes."
Natural Translation
The product complies with European standards.
Literal Translation
The product is in conformity with European norms.
